TL;DR
The chalky texture in soy milk is primarily caused by a high concentration of fine, suspended soy solids left over from the manufacturing process. This is a quality issue related to how the beans are ground and filtered, not a sign of spoilage. You can find smoother soy milk by trying different brands or by improving your homemade technique with better straining.
What Causes the Chalky Texture in Soy Milk?
If you’ve ever poured a glass of soy milk and found the texture unpleasantly gritty or powdery, you’re not alone. Many describe the sensation as chalky, or as one writer put it, like drinking a “pureed bean soup.” This mouthfeel is a common complaint, but it stems from the physical properties of the beverage, not from a lack of freshness. The primary culprit is the concentration of tiny particles of the soybean that remain suspended in the liquid.
Scientific research confirms this direct relationship. A study published in the Journal of Food Science found that chalkiness is a defect that coats the mouth with fine, grainy particles, and its intensity “increased with soy solids concentration.” Essentially, the more microscopic bits of bean that make it into the final product, the more pronounced the chalky feeling becomes. These particles are so small that they don’t feel chunky, but rather create a fine, powdery coating on your tongue and throat.
The manufacturing process plays a huge role in the final texture. Commercial producers use various methods to minimize this effect, such as high-pressure homogenization and centrifugal desludging, which can reduce chalkiness to an imperceptible level. However, the effectiveness of these processes can vary between brands. In homemade soy milk, the chalkiness often comes from not blending the soaked beans finely enough or, more commonly, from inadequate straining. If the cloth or nut milk bag used for filtration isn’t fine enough, more of these solids will pass through into the milk.
Beyond soy solids, other compounds can contribute to an undesirable mouthfeel. Factors like oxidized phospholipids and fatty acids can create sour, bitter, or astringent flavors that enhance the perception of a poor texture. Some manufacturers may add sugars, flavorings, or emulsifying agents like gums to mask these off-notes and create a creamier, more pleasant consistency.

Is It Just Chalky, or Has It Gone Bad?
It’s a common concern: you notice an odd texture and immediately wonder if your soy milk is safe to drink. The good news is that a chalky texture is not an indicator of spoilage. Chalkiness is a consistent quality of the milk from the moment it was made, whereas spoilage involves a distinct change in the milk’s characteristics over time due to bacterial growth. Knowing the difference is key to ensuring food safety and preventing unnecessary waste.
The signs of spoiled soy milk are much more dramatic and obvious than a simple gritty texture. The most telling indicator is a change in consistency. Spoiled soy milk will often become lumpy, clumpy, or curdled, separating into solids and watery liquid. Another clear sign is the smell; if it has a sour, rancid, or otherwise unpleasant odor, it has gone bad. Finally, a visual check can reveal spoilage. Fresh soy milk is typically an off-white color, but spoiled milk may turn yellowish or grayish. Any visible mold is, of course, a definitive reason to discard it.
To help you distinguish between a simple texture issue and a safety concern, here is a clear comparison:
| Indicator | Chalky Texture (Normal) | Spoiled Milk (Unsafe) |
|---|---|---|
| Texture | Fine, powdery, or slightly gritty mouthfeel | Lumpy, clumpy, curdled, or separated |
| Smell | Normal, beany smell | Sour, rancid, or off-putting odor |
| Color | Consistent off-white or beige | Yellowish, grayish, or discolored |
| Consistency | Smooth, uniform liquid | Thickened in parts, separated solids |
If you’re ever in doubt, follow this simple checklist before drinking:
- Check the expiration date. While not foolproof, it’s the first line of defense.
- Smell the milk. Your nose is a powerful tool for detecting spoilage. Any sour notes are a red flag.
- Pour a small amount into a glass. Look closely for any clumps, separation, or discoloration.
- When in doubt, throw it out. It’s always better to be safe than sorry.
How to Find or Make Smoother, Less Chalky Soy Milk
Fortunately, you don’t have to settle for chalky soy milk. Whether you prefer the convenience of store-bought options or the freshness of homemade, there are clear strategies you can use to achieve a smoother, creamier beverage. The solution lies in either selecting a product that has been processed for a better texture or refining your own technique to remove more of the solids.
When shopping for soy milk, don’t assume all brands are the same. The level of chalkiness varies significantly due to different manufacturing processes. If you’re unhappy with one brand, try another. You may also want to look for specific terms on the packaging that suggest a smoother texture, such as:
- Ultra-filtered: This indicates a more rigorous process to remove suspended particles.
- Creamy or Original: These versions are often formulated for a richer mouthfeel, sometimes with the help of added stabilizers or emulsifiers.
- Barista Blends: These are specifically designed to be smooth and stable for use in coffee and often have a superior texture.
For those who prefer to make soy milk at home, you have complete control over the final texture. Using a high-powered blender is essential for breaking down the soybeans into the finest possible particles. However, the most critical step for eliminating chalkiness is thorough straining. For those serious about homemade plant milks, investing in a dedicated machine can make all the difference. Resources like Soy Milk Quick offer detailed comparisons of plant milk makers to help you find one that fits your needs, ensuring a consistently smooth result. According to some experts, some speedy machines that skip proper soaking and cooking can result in a product full of antinutrients, leading to digestive issues.
Follow these steps for a noticeably smoother homemade soy milk:
- Soak the Beans Properly: Soak high-quality soybeans in plenty of water for at least 8-12 hours, or overnight. This softens them for a finer blend.
- Blend Thoroughly: Use a high-powered blender and a good ratio of water to beans (typically around 3-4 cups of water per 1 cup of soaked beans). Blend for at least 1-2 minutes until completely smooth.
- Strain Meticulously: This is the most important step. Pour the blended mixture through a fine-mesh nut milk bag or several layers of cheesecloth. Squeeze firmly and patiently to extract all the liquid, leaving the pulp (okara) behind. For an even smoother result, you can strain the milk a second time.
- Cook Gently: Bring the strained milk to a gentle simmer for about 15-20 minutes, stirring occasionally to prevent a skin from forming. This cooks the milk, improves its flavor, and makes it easier to digest.
Frequently Asked Questions
1. Why is my soy milk grainy?
A grainy texture in soy milk is caused by the same issue as chalkiness: suspended particles from the soybeans. This is often a result of insufficient filtering during the production process. In homemade versions, it can also mean the soybeans weren’t blended finely enough before straining.
2. How do I know if soy milk has gone bad?
You can tell soy milk has gone bad by looking for several key signs. These include a lumpy or curdled texture, a sour or rancid smell, and a color that has changed from off-white to yellowish or gray. If you notice any of these changes, the milk should be discarded.
3. Is soy milk supposed to be clumpy?
No, soy milk should not be clumpy. A smooth, consistent liquid is the normal state for fresh soy milk. Clumps or curdles are a definitive sign that the milk has spoiled and is no longer safe to consume.